I’ll pick you up at dusk

A 25-part photo essay.

 

The car has always been much more than a way to get from point A to point B. The nostalgia, passion, and bonding experiences in a car are those that stick with you throughout your entire life. Inspired by such experiences in my own life, ‘I’ll pick you up at dusk’ documents the late night conversations had while in the car. It consists of 5 acts, each one propelling the viewer through the natural progression of a deep conversation between a boy and a girl. Each act also has a song tied to it’s photos and it’s meaning, through a playlist curated for the trip. This snapshot of musical inspiration, combined with rhetorical questions against a backdrop of night photography makes the viewer examine the importance of deep talks and building true human connections in one of our most treasured pastimes.

‘I’ll pick you up at dusk’ was originally presented as a self-published virtual exhibition during the height of the COVID-19 pandemic in the winter of 2020. The essay has now been compiled into a film for easy viewing.
